Output ecfa545246a030abaea2aadf0273973dff935e085c1e3d7699d800974252b0f4:13

value
752908257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539917776a5f61d53010498038e62dd5dc43ecd0 OP_EQUAL
address
MFXBiM7NRmam2kewmCLZH2puhzdceGdEMu
transaction
ecfa545246a030abaea2aadf0273973dff935e085c1e3d7699d800974252b0f4
spent
true